  • Patent number: 11604230
    Abstract: An electric circuit for driving a current through a load resistance in a first state and isolating the load resistance in a second state includes: a first switch configured to connect a first terminal of the load resistance and a first port of the electric circuit, the first switch having a first electric potential; a second switch configured to connect a second terminal of the load resistance and a second port of the electric circuit, the second switch having a second electric potential, different from the first electric potential; and at least one auxiliary resistance included within a bypass line configured to bypass the load resistance and the second switch. The first switch is configured to switch a current flowing through the first switch, and the second switch is configured to switch a current flowing through the second switch.

  • Patent number: 10386221
    Abstract: The disclosure relates to a method for determining a level of a liquid in a tank with an ultrasonic fill state sensor and at least two reference surfaces for reflecting an ultrasonic wave transmitted by the ultrasonic fill state sensor. A first reference surface is arranged below a second reference surface. The method includes determining a first propagation speed of an ultrasonic wave to the first reference surface on a first measurement path and a second propagation speed from the first reference surface to the second reference surface on a second measurement path. The method also includes measuring a propagation time of an ultrasonic wave from the ultrasonic fill state sensor to a liquid level of the liquid in the tank, selecting the first propagation speed or the second propagation speed based on at least one selection criterion, and calculating a fill state using the propagation time measured.

  • Patent number: 10145722
    Abstract: A method for manufacturing a tank for a motor vehicle for storing a liquid additive with a calibrated sensor for determining at least one parameter of the liquid additive in the tank. In a step a) the sensor is installed in the tank. In a step b) the tank is at least partially filled with a predefined quantity of a test liquid. In a step c) a signal of the sensor is determined, and in a step d) the sensor is calibrated with the signal.

  • Patent number: 6708478
    Abstract: The invention pertains to a device and procedure to regulate the bale length in a square baler. Sensors determine both the forward and backward movement of the crop bundle and transfer these measurements to an evaluation electronic. The evaluation electronic adds the measurements and triggers the tying process when the actual length value is reached. The procedure includes the steps of: sensing both the forward and backward movement of a crop bundle in a baling chamber; adding the measured forward and backward movements to determine an actual length value of the crop bundle; and triggering the tying device once a pre-set target actual length value is reached.

  • Patent number: 6318250
    Abstract: A device for actuating the clutch of a twine wrap device in a big square baler for harvested crops has a pawl attached to the clutch, a shift lever pivotable into the orbit of the pawl, a control device for the shift lever, and an electric motor which is drive-connected with the control device for the shift lever. The electric motor may be connected via an electric circuit with a device for determining the bale length.

  • Patent number: 6112507
    Abstract: A square baler has a pick-up device, a feeding channel, a baling chamber with a baling ram, side walls of the baling chamber, a hydraulic adjustment device to change the position of at least one pivotal side wall and corresponding sensors and control devices, which regulate the side walls. A control device regulates the baling force of the square baler. A pressure sensor measures the baling pressure in the hydraulic adjustment device. The baling pressure is then compared with a set pressure value. The difference in the value of the pressures is processed via a PID controller, which sends an adjustment signal to a hydraulic valve for adjusting the difference in the actual and set pressures.

  • Patent number: 6073426
    Abstract: A system is provided to monitor and control operational functions in a baler such as a big square baler. Clutches and drive components associated with the system are switchable via a speed regulator. Depending on the switch position of the clutches, additional adjusting devices can be engaged or disengaged. The system automatically swings the cutting knives into and out of the feed channel to preclude clogging of the knife slots in the bottom of the feeding channel. It is advantageous to build such a system with several job processing units sharing the same processing software and, at least in part, identical hardware.

  • Patent number: 5880684
    Abstract: An operator device for controlling control units associated with a pulled working machine and arranged on a pulling working machine, the operator device has a plurality of operator elements, and a multi-function handle having a handle part turnable to several control positions and having a head, an operator field arranged in a region of the head of the handle part and provided with the operator elements for actuation of control functions, and a bus system transmitting control signals of the multi-function handle to at least one of the adjusting units.
